Verstappen ready to trade engine penalties for performance

Red Bull Racing's Max Verstappen is ready to pay the price in the form of grid penalties for Honda's improved performance this season. The Japanese manufacturer has supplied both Red Bull and Toro Rosso with an updated power unit for Baku, with the changes eating in to the engine allocation of both teams' drivers. Verstappen claims to be unfazed however by the spectre of potential grid demotions materializing down the road as Red Bull's exceeds its engine quota. "Actually I'm really happy because they keep pushing really hard to bring updates and that's always good," said the Dutchman in Baku.
